What is Americas Sales Operations?

Americas Sales Operations refers to the team or function responsible for supporting and optimizing the sales process for regions within the Americas, such as North, Central, and South America. This team manages sales analytics, forecasting, territory planning, process improvement, and sales technology to help sales teams reach their targets efficiently. They work closely with sales leadership, marketing, finance, and other departments to ensure smooth operations. Their goal is to streamline workflows, provide actionable insights, and remove obstacles to maximize sales effectiveness. The role is vital for achieving sales objectives and maintaining a competitive edge in the market.

What is the difference between Americas Sales Operations vs Americas Sales Support?

AspectAmericas Sales OperationsAmericas Sales Support
Primary FocusSales process optimization, data analysis, CRM managementCustomer assistance, order processing, sales documentation
Required SkillsData analysis, CRM tools, sales processesCustomer service, communication, administrative skills
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, cross-functional teamsOffice or remote, customer-facing
Common CertificationsSalesforce certifications, data analysis coursesCustomer service certifications, administrative training

Americas Sales Operations focuses on streamlining sales processes and analyzing data to support sales strategies, while Americas Sales Support handles customer interactions and order processing. Both roles are essential in sales teams but serve different functions within the sales ecosystem.

How does the Americas Sales Operations team typically collaborate with sales and marketing departments to drive regional growth?

In the Americas Sales Operations role, you will regularly partner with both sales and marketing teams to align strategies, streamline processes, and ensure data-driven decision making. This often involves facilitating communication between departments, managing CRM tools, and supporting campaign execution to optimize lead generation and sales performance. Collaboration is key, as you’ll help translate high-level business goals into actionable plans, monitor key metrics, and provide insights that drive revenue growth across multiple regions.
